- Long description
- Flint, fire steel & sulphur cup attached by leather thong. The flint is square and attached to a metal chain with a metal bracket. The fire steel is rectangular with a rectangular opening and incised with diagonal lines radiation from the corners of the opening. The horn cup is circular and with a projecting handle.
